This video will show you how to remove and replace the tail light yourself if it's cloudy, cracked, or broken

Both replacing the bulbs or replacing the whole taillight assembly on a Focus three door. Tools you'll need are a Phillips screwdriver and that should be about it, actually.
There's a screw right here, and then, in underneath, there is a finger nut right there. You can just grab on that out with your fingers and twist it. The first thing we'll remove. The light comes out. If you're looking to replace a bulb, right up here, this turns counterclockwise and comes out. This one, same thing. Counterclockwise and comes out. To replace this whole assembly you're going to want to pull these little tabs off. There, that's off. These bulbs just pull out and I'm not sure, on this car, whether that should be a orange bulb or not. Looks a little weird. Think it should be clear. This one pulls out, goes back in.
For reinstallation, we can put our bulbs back in. Put these little harness holders back into place. Put that down in. Start our screw in. Back under here, put our thumb screw in. Don't make it too tight because as it gets older it'll tighten up more and it'll be hard to get off.
